<?xml version="1.0" encoding="UTF-8"?><rss version="2.0"
	xmlns:content="http://purl.org/rss/1.0/modules/content/"
	xmlns:wfw="http://wellformedweb.org/CommentAPI/"
	xmlns:dc="http://purl.org/dc/elements/1.1/"
	xmlns:atom="http://www.w3.org/2005/Atom"
	xmlns:sy="http://purl.org/rss/1.0/modules/syndication/"
	xmlns:slash="http://purl.org/rss/1.0/modules/slash/"
	>

<channel>
	<title>pattern matching - NullPointerException.pl</title>
	<atom:link href="https://nullpointerexception.pl/tag/pattern-matching/feed/" rel="self" type="application/rss+xml" />
	<link>https://nullpointerexception.pl/tag/pattern-matching/</link>
	<description>Blog o programowaniu w Javie</description>
	<lastBuildDate>Fri, 04 Aug 2023 17:07:26 +0000</lastBuildDate>
	<language>pl-PL</language>
	<sy:updatePeriod>
	hourly	</sy:updatePeriod>
	<sy:updateFrequency>
	1	</sy:updateFrequency>
	<generator>https://wordpress.org/?v=6.9</generator>

<image>
	<url>https://nullpointerexception.pl/wp-content/uploads/2019/04/icon.png</url>
	<title>pattern matching - NullPointerException.pl</title>
	<link>https://nullpointerexception.pl/tag/pattern-matching/</link>
	<width>32</width>
	<height>32</height>
</image> 
	<item>
		<title>Java 17 LTS</title>
		<link>https://nullpointerexception.pl/java-17-lts/</link>
					<comments>https://nullpointerexception.pl/java-17-lts/#comments</comments>
		
		<dc:creator><![CDATA[Mateusz Dąbrowski]]></dc:creator>
		<pubDate>Thu, 16 Sep 2021 07:40:07 +0000</pubDate>
				<category><![CDATA[Java]]></category>
		<category><![CDATA[Java 14]]></category>
		<category><![CDATA[Java 17]]></category>
		<category><![CDATA[Java 21]]></category>
		<category><![CDATA[Java pattern matching]]></category>
		<category><![CDATA[Java switch expression]]></category>
		<category><![CDATA[pattern matching]]></category>
		<category><![CDATA[Sealed Classes]]></category>
		<guid isPermaLink="false">https://nullpointerexception.pl/?p=3188</guid>

					<description><![CDATA[<p>Kolejna wersja Javy wylądowała. Od 14 września jest już dostępna Java 17. Nowa wersja Javy zawiera aż 14 zmian tzw. JEP (JDK Enhancement Proposal). Mimo tak dużej ilości JEPów, to samych zmian istotnych dla developerów aplikacji jest tak naprawdę niewiele. Zacznę od tego, że nowa wersja jest wersją z długim wsparciem, czyli LTS (Long Term [&#8230;]</p>
<p>Artykuł <a href="https://nullpointerexception.pl/java-17-lts/">Java 17 LTS</a> pochodzi z serwisu <a href="https://nullpointerexception.pl">NullPointerException.pl</a>.</p>
]]></description>
		
					<wfw:commentRss>https://nullpointerexception.pl/java-17-lts/feed/</wfw:commentRss>
			<slash:comments>2</slash:comments>
		
		
			</item>
		<item>
		<title>Java 13 przegląd nowości</title>
		<link>https://nullpointerexception.pl/java-13-przeglad-nowosci/</link>
		
		<dc:creator><![CDATA[Mateusz Dąbrowski]]></dc:creator>
		<pubDate>Tue, 17 Sep 2019 07:35:33 +0000</pubDate>
				<category><![CDATA[Java]]></category>
		<category><![CDATA[instrukcja switch]]></category>
		<category><![CDATA[Java 10]]></category>
		<category><![CDATA[Java 11]]></category>
		<category><![CDATA[Java 12]]></category>
		<category><![CDATA[Java 13]]></category>
		<category><![CDATA[Java 8]]></category>
		<category><![CDATA[Java 9]]></category>
		<category><![CDATA[JDK]]></category>
		<category><![CDATA[JVM]]></category>
		<category><![CDATA[pattern matching]]></category>
		<category><![CDATA[switch expression]]></category>
		<category><![CDATA[Text Blocks]]></category>
		<guid isPermaLink="false">http://nullpointerexception.pl/?p=347</guid>

					<description><![CDATA[<p>Kolejna, trzynasta wersja Javy ujrzała dzisiaj światło dzienne. Java 13 wprowadza kila małych nowości. Zmiany w samym języku są tylko dwie, a jedna z nich jest modyfikacją już wprowadzonej wcześniej zmiany w Javie 12, za to więcej zmian dotknęło samą platformę JVM. Switch Expressions (Preview) To  już kolejna odsłona zmodyfikowanej instrukcji switch. Pierwsza miała miejsce [&#8230;]</p>
<p>Artykuł <a href="https://nullpointerexception.pl/java-13-przeglad-nowosci/">Java 13 przegląd nowości</a> pochodzi z serwisu <a href="https://nullpointerexception.pl">NullPointerException.pl</a>.</p>
]]></description>
		
		
		
			</item>
		<item>
		<title>Java 12 nowości</title>
		<link>https://nullpointerexception.pl/java-12-nowosci/</link>
		
		<dc:creator><![CDATA[Mateusz Dąbrowski]]></dc:creator>
		<pubDate>Sat, 27 Apr 2019 18:49:23 +0000</pubDate>
				<category><![CDATA[Java]]></category>
		<category><![CDATA[instrukcja switch]]></category>
		<category><![CDATA[Java 10]]></category>
		<category><![CDATA[Java 11]]></category>
		<category><![CDATA[Java 12]]></category>
		<category><![CDATA[Java 8]]></category>
		<category><![CDATA[Java 9]]></category>
		<category><![CDATA[pattern matching]]></category>
		<category><![CDATA[switch expression]]></category>
		<guid isPermaLink="false">http://nullpointerexception.pl/?p=259</guid>

					<description><![CDATA[<p>Od niedawna jest już dostępna Java 12. Pojawiła się dokładnie 19.03.2019. W związku z tym, że Java 12 nie jest wersją LTS (Long Term Support), tak jak miało to miejsce w przypadku poprzedniej wersji Java 11, nie wnosi zbyt wiele nowości dla developerów. Poniżej lista zmian, które weszły w nowej wersji Javy: Wyrażenie switch (Switch Expressions) &#8211; [&#8230;]</p>
<p>Artykuł <a href="https://nullpointerexception.pl/java-12-nowosci/">Java 12 nowości</a> pochodzi z serwisu <a href="https://nullpointerexception.pl">NullPointerException.pl</a>.</p>
]]></description>
		
		
		
			</item>
	</channel>
</rss>
